The Intex 64447ED Dura-Beam Deluxe Ultra Plush Air Mattress redefines portable luxury with an 18-inch elevated design, built-in electric pump for rapid inflation, and robust Fiber-Tech construction supporting up to 600 pounds. Featuring a plush velvety surface and ergonomic headboard, it combines durability with comfort, making it ideal for professionals seeking a stylish, reliable sleep solution at home or on the move.

Leaking In Less Than A Year- HORRIBLE Customer Service
DON'T BUY! I gave this a 1 star rating because I couldn't go lower. It falsely posted with 5 stars. I haven't had this air bed a year and it's leaking badly. I only use it a few days each month in a carpeted bedroom. Otherwise it's kept neatly folded in it's bag. I recently inflated it and kept waking up about every 3 hours having to re-inflate it. I woke up with my back and neck hurting, and extremely sleep deprived. I tried for several days to keep it inflated and to find where the slow leak was coming from. Then I left town and contacted the seller. He replied that I should contact Intex because it's still under warranty. I ended up speaking with a Rep who stated to file a claim I had to find the pinhole leak and cut out a 6x6 inch section of the airbed where it was leaking, then take a picture of the Intex logo on the bed. After taking this dangerous action of stabbing and cutting up the layered and reinforced airbed, she said take a picture of the cut out and upload it and the logo picture to the claim website. She said Intex will not honor their warranty if this isn't done. She also said if approved it would take months to receive the replacement. I asked what am I supposed to sleep on after destroying the airbed and waiting for months. She couldn't care less. She also refused to transfer me to a supervisor. I searched again and discovered the leak was at the pump. I took a picture of the pump and of the now almost deflated Intex logo and uploaded it with a copy of my Amazon shipping receipt. They immediately denied my claim. I called and the Rep said I didn't send pictures of the cut up airbed. I asked for a supervisor. She put me on hold a long time and when she came back she pretended that she couldn't hear me and hung up. Although she had initially asked for all of my info at the beginning of the call, including my phone number, she didn't call back. Amazon won't help because they state it's a 3rd party vendor. I haven't even been able to reach a human Amazon Customer Service Rep. I filed a complaint with my State Attorney General's office and the FTC due to shoddy defective material, lack of customer service and refusing to honor the warranty.
